  Trust Based Content Distribution for Peer-To-Peer Overlay Networks

Inhoud: In peer-to-peer content distribution the lack of a central authority makes authentication difficult.Without authentication, adversary nodes can spoof identity and falsify messages in the overlay. Thisenables malicious nodes to launch man-in-the-middle or denial of-service attacks. In this paper, we present a trust based content distribution for peer-to-peer overlay networks, which is built on the trust management scheme. The main concept is, before sending or accepting the traffic, the trust of the peer must be validated. Based on the success of data delivery and searching time, we calculate the trust index of a node.Then the aggregated trust index of the peers whose value is below the threshold value is considered as distrusted and the corresponding traffic is blocked. By simulation results we show that our proposed scheme achieves increased success ratio with reduced delay and drop
